Albert W Mohr 1919 - 2001

Albert W Mohr of Spokane, Spokane County, WA was born on December 27, 1919, and died at age 81 years old on October 3, 2001.

  • Military Service

    Military serial#: 06937938 Enlisted: December 6, 1945 in Santa Ana Aab California Military branch: Air Corps Master Sergeant Regular Army (including Officers, Nurses, Warrant Officers, And Enlisted Men) Terms of enlistment: Enlistment For Hawaiian Department

In 1919, in the year that Albert W Mohr was born, on January 6th, President Theodore Roosevelt died. Having gone to bed the previous night after being treated for breathing problems, the ex-President died in his sleep from a clot that had traveled to his lungs. He was 60. After a simple service, Roosevelt was buried on a hillside overlooking Oyster Bay.
